The Visualization and Immersive Technologies Department (VITD) develops a wide variety of innovative tools and applications to support civil, commercial, and national security space systems. From virtual reality and augmented reality, to web, cloud, and desktop visualization, VITD evaluates and creates unique visual experiences that present data and analysis to key decision makers.
Key Functions
- Support industry leading engineers and scientists in the development of immersive technology applications to visualize complex engineering problems
- Work with a team to build game engine simulations that include: game engine asset layout, realistic lighting effects, animation scripts, haptic design and user satisfaction consideration
- Collaborate with developers to produce data visualization software, that incorporates touch and gesture components, while displaying complex data sets
- Participate in multiple technology exploratory and research efforts to evaluate the immersive technologies on the market today in relation to the needs of the company

The Aerospace Corporation has provided independent technical and scientific research, development, and advisory services to national security space programs since 1960. We operate a federally funded research and development center (FFRDC) for the United States Air Force and the National Reconnaissance Office, and support all national security space programs. We also apply more than 50 years of experience with space systems to provide critical solutions to technologically complex systems in such areas as communications, shipping, law enforcement, and cyber, among others.
